My Buying Guides on Motorbike Bags Waterproof
Why I Care About Waterproofing
When I choose a motorbike bag, waterproofing is one of the first things I look at. I have learned that a sudden rain shower can ruin clothes, electronics, documents, and even snacks if the bag is not properly sealed. For me, a truly waterproof bag gives peace of mind on daily commutes, long rides, and weekend trips.
What I Check Before Buying
I always start by looking at how the bag is built. I prefer welded seams, roll-top closures, and water-resistant zippers because these details make a big difference. I also check whether the bag is made from durable materials like PVC, tarpaulin, or coated nylon. In my experience, a bag may look tough, but the real test is how well it handles heavy rain and road spray.
The Right Size for My Needs
I choose the size based on how I ride. For short trips, I usually want a compact bag that carries my essentials without feeling bulky. For touring, I need something larger that can hold extra clothes, tools, and a charger. I have found that buying a bag that is too large can make the bike harder to handle, while one that is too small becomes frustrating very quickly.
Comfort and Fit Matter to Me
I never ignore how the bag fits on my motorbike. A good waterproof bag should sit securely without shifting around at speed. If I am buying a backpack-style motorbike bag, I look for padded straps and a breathable back panel. If it is a tank bag, tail bag, or saddle bag, I make sure it mounts easily and does not interfere with my riding position.
Storage Features I Prefer
I like bags with useful compartments because they help me stay organized. Separate pockets for my phone, wallet, keys, and tools save me time when I stop. I also appreciate external attachment points if I need to carry a helmet, gloves, or rain cover. In my experience, a well-designed interior is just as important as waterproof material.
Durability and Build Quality
I pay attention to stitching, buckles, straps, and zippers because these are the parts that usually fail first. A strong waterproof bag should feel solid and dependable. I look for reinforced stress points and high-quality hardware, especially if I plan to use the bag often. I have learned that a cheap bag can cost more in the long run if it wears out too quickly.
Safety Features I Look For
When I ride at night or in low visibility, I want reflective details on the bag. These small features help other road users notice me more easily. I also like bags that sit close to the bike and do not flap in the wind. To me, safety is not only about protection from rain but also about staying visible and stable on the road.
Easy Cleaning and Maintenance
I prefer a bag that is easy to wipe clean after muddy or wet rides. Waterproof materials usually make maintenance simpler, which is another reason I like them. I try to avoid bags that absorb dirt or hold moisture for too long. In my experience, a bag that dries quickly and cleans easily stays useful for much longer.
